Patents by Inventor Xiao Yan
Xiao Yan has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 12277066Abstract: A method, including: monitoring resource utilization of an operating system (OS) with applications utilizing larger pages; determining the monitored resource utilization is greater than a threshold resource utilization; in response to the determining the monitored resource utilization is greater than a threshold resource utilization, determining a respective larger pages index value for each of the applications utilizing larger pages; and turning off larger pages utilization of a subset of the applications utilizing larger pages, wherein the subset comprises a predefined number of the applications utilizing larger pages that have highest determined larger pages index values.Type: GrantFiled: December 21, 2022Date of Patent: April 15, 2025Assignee: International Business Machines CorporationInventors: Dong Hui Liu, Jing Lu, Peng Hui Jiang, Naijie Li, Xiao Yan Tang, Bao Zhang, Jun Su, Yong Yin, Jia Yu
-
Publication number: 20250094316Abstract: For a set in sets of candidate factors, a classification model is trained to predict a computer problem possibility, an accuracy score of the classification model is determined based on model validation, and factor weights of the candidate factors in the set are adjusted based on the accuracy score. This processing is done with respect to all sets of candidate factors. A low accuracy classification model having an accuracy score lower than a threshold criterion is selected. A higher accuracy classification model having an accuracy score that is higher than the accuracy score of the low accuracy classification model is selected. The set of candidate factors used to train the low accuracy classification model is updated using one or more of the candidate factors used to train the higher accuracy classification model. The low accuracy classification model is updated based on the updated set of candidate factors.Type: ApplicationFiled: September 18, 2023Publication date: March 20, 2025Inventors: Dong Hui Liu, Jing Lu, Peng Hui Jiang, Xiao Yan Tang, Jun Su, Jia Yu
-
Patent number: 12248456Abstract: A computer-implemented method, system and computer program product for improving accuracy and efficiency of auditing databases. A table, list or index of a database is analyzed to identify metadata, which includes time series data, user data, an Internet Protocol address and operation data. The identified metadata is associated with the corresponding record or row of the table, list or index from which the metadata was extracted. A determination is then made as to whether to record a raw data image associated with the record or row of the analyzed table, list or index based on the corresponding data operation. The identified metadata as well as the recorded data images, if any, are stored in a structured audit log. Auditing information is then obtained from a structured audit log based on matching the record or row identifier (RID) associated with the query with the RID associated with the structured audit log.Type: GrantFiled: March 30, 2022Date of Patent: March 11, 2025Assignee: International Business Machines CorporationInventors: Jia Tian Zhong, Peng Hui Jiang, Dong Hui Liu, Xing Xing Shen, Jia Yu, Yong Yin, Jing Lu, Xiao Yan Tang
-
Patent number: 12241936Abstract: The invention provides methods, devices and non-transitory tangible computer-readable storage media for estimating a state of charge of a battery and extracting a charging curve of the battery. The method for estimating the state of charge of the battery includes estimating a first state of charge of the battery; determining a charging curve that conforms to the present charging scenario, wherein the present charging scenario is characterized by at least one of parameters including an ambient temperature, a charging rate, an internal resistance, a state of health, a lifespan, and an open circuit voltage of the battery; and correcting the first state of charge according to the charging curve to obtain a final state of charge of the battery.Type: GrantFiled: January 25, 2023Date of Patent: March 4, 2025Assignee: SHANGHAI MAKESENS ENERGY STORAGE TECHNOLOGY CO., LTD.Inventors: Peng Ding, Xiao Yan, Enhai Zhao, Danfei Gu, Pingchao Hao, Pei Song, Weikun Wu, Xiaohua Chen, Guopeng Zhou, Mingchen Jiang
-
Patent number: 12222395Abstract: A method, an apparatus and a device for identifying battery parameters, and a storage medium are provided.Type: GrantFiled: November 29, 2023Date of Patent: February 11, 2025Assignee: SHANGHAI MAKESENS ENERGY STORAGE TECHNOLOGY CO., LTD.Inventors: Xiaohua Chen, Zhimin Zhou, Qiong Wei, Xiao Yan, Enhai Zhao, Pingchao Hao, Zhou Yang
-
Patent number: 12216370Abstract: A display panel is provided, which includes a first substrate and a second substrate arranged opposite to each other. The first substrate includes a first electrode and a second electrode. The second substrate includes a light shielding layer. The light shielding layer includes a light transmitting region and a light shielding region. The first electrode includes slits extending in a first direction, and an orthographic projection of two ends of at least one of the slits onto the first substrate is within an orthographic projection of the light shielding region onto the first substrate. A display panel and a display device are also provided.Type: GrantFiled: May 11, 2022Date of Patent: February 4, 2025Assignees: ORDOS YUANSHENG OPTOELECTRONICS CO., LTD., BOE TECHNOLOGY GROUP CO., LTD.Inventors: Jing Li, Yanan Yu, Zhao Liu, Rui Fan, Xiao Yan, Haoyi Xin, Jianxiong Fan, Shangpeng Liu, Jingjing Xu, Min Zhang, Wei Ren, Chenrong Qiao, Yanfeng Li
-
Publication number: 20250036468Abstract: The illustrative embodiments provide for dynamic tuning of pre-initialization environment provisioning and management. An embodiment includes accepting a request from a group of applications to generate a performance-based index table for a workload based on a feature of the applications and generating the performance-based index table. The embodiment includes building a label feature by analyzing a static program feature of the applications and the performance-based index table. The embodiment includes constructing, using clustering algorithms, a model for provisioning a pre-initialization environment using the label features. The embodiment includes loading the applications into a pre-initialization environment. The embodiment includes introducing a selection policy for a switch in the pre-initialization environment in multiple applications to balance usage of a resource.Type: ApplicationFiled: July 24, 2023Publication date: January 30, 2025Applicant: International Business Machines CorporationInventors: Dong Hui Liu, Jing Lu, Peng Hui Jiang, NAIJIE LI, Xiao Yan Tang, Jia Yu
-
Publication number: 20250028558Abstract: A system and method for improving the performance and reducing costs of a program by automatically provisioning and managing proper memory pool cell size adaptive to each executing application. By collecting time series of historical data on the memory pool usage of applications over a period of time, respective time-series prediction models are used to process the data to predict the allocation size for applications and in particular, a predicted number of allocations and a respective predicted allocation cell size. A clustering-based method is further applied to predict the allocation size for applications, using real time execution to do scaling, complement and interpolation. A method runs a further time-series prediction model trained to predict, based on the predicted memory cell size and one or more application profile features associated with the requesting application, a tuning parameter to refine the memory pool storage area size used for handling memory allocation requests.Type: ApplicationFiled: July 21, 2023Publication date: January 23, 2025Inventors: Dong Hui Liu, Peng Hui Jiang, Jing Lu, Xiao Yan Tang, NAIJIE LI, Jun Su, Jia Yu
-
Patent number: 12201950Abstract: Devices and methods related to a graphene oxide-based membrane are provided. A method comprises immersing graphene oxide-based layers in a water-based solution, stirring the water-based solution in a swirling motion until the graphene oxide-based layers each physically curve, adding a crosslinker to the water-based solution to cause the formation of saccate graphene oxide-based cells that are connected to each other via channels, and stacking the saccate graphene oxide-based cells on a substrate to form a graphene oxide-based membrane.Type: GrantFiled: June 14, 2019Date of Patent: January 21, 2025Assignee: VERSITECH LIMITEDInventors: Xiao Yan Li, Hai Bo Li
-
Patent number: 12204827Abstract: A method for establishing an electrochemical model for an ion battery is provided. The ion battery includes a negative electrode region, a positive electrode region, and a diaphragm arranged between the negative electrode region and the positive electrode region. The negative electrode region includes a negative electrode current collector, a negative electrode liquid phase and a negative electrode solid phase. The positive electrode region includes a positive electrode current collector, a positive electrode liquid phase and a positive electrode solid phase.Type: GrantFiled: May 30, 2023Date of Patent: January 21, 2025Assignee: SHANGHAI MAKESENS ENERGY STORAGE TECHNOLOGY CO., LTD.Inventors: Enhai Zhao, Xiao Yan, Xiaohua Chen, Danfei Gu, Pingchao Hao, Pei Song, Peng Ding, Weikun Wu
-
Patent number: 12197901Abstract: In a first aspect of the invention, there is a computer-implemented method including: generating, by one or more processors, dependency version information for a target software application, based on activity of a compiler registered with an event handler; generating, by the one or more processors, one or more dependency sections with a dependency list for the target software application, wherein the dependency list incorporates the dependency version information; and building, by the one or more processors, a software package with the one or more dependency sections with the dependency list for the target software application.Type: GrantFiled: December 21, 2022Date of Patent: January 14, 2025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ATIONInventors: Bao Zhang, Jing Lu, Dong Hui Liu, Peng Hui Jiang, Xiao Yan Tang, Yong Yin, Jia Yu
-
Publication number: 20250007961Abstract: Disclosed are a method and a device for obtaining business x detail record (XDR), and a storage medium. The method for obtaining business XDR is applied to a first device and includes: receiving business XDR sent by a second device, where the business XDR is generated based on business data collected from a user plane; searching target signaling XDR in signaling XDR sent by a third device according to the business XDR and a preset association between business and signaling, where the signaling XDR is generated based on information related to business in a signaling collected from a control plane; and updating the business XDR according to the target signaling XDR.Type: ApplicationFiled: October 25, 2022Publication date: January 2, 2025Inventors: Hongfang AI, Haitao ZHANG, Xiao YAN
-
Patent number: 12147352Abstract: A method, including: identifying static application features of an application; identifying resource access features of the application; labeling a translation lookaside buffer (TLB) miss threshold of a runtime feature of the application; determining utilization of larger pages during the runtime based on the TLB miss threshold; and setting the TLB miss threshold based on the determined utilization of the larger pages.Type: GrantFiled: October 20, 2022Date of Patent: November 19, 2024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ATIONInventors: Naijie Li, Dong Hui Liu, Jing Lu, Peng Hui Jiang, Xiao Yan Tang, Bao Zhang, Yong Yin, Jun Su, Jia Yu
-
Patent number: 12113360Abstract: A method and a device for forecasting an electric load, an electronic device, and a computer-readable storage medium are provided. The method includes: acquiring historical load data prior to a forecast date; generating a load sequence based on the historical load data; performing variational mode decomposition on the load sequence, to obtain multiple intrinsic mode components and a residual that are corresponding to the load sequence; and inputting the multiple intrinsic mode components and the residual into respective forecasting models, and determining a load value on the forecast date based on forecasting results of all the forecasting models.Type: GrantFiled: September 6, 2023Date of Patent: October 8, 2024Assignee: SHANGHAI MAKESENS ENERGY STORAGE TECHNOLOGY CO., LTD.Inventors: Decheng Wang, Peng Ding, Weikun Wu, Haowen Ren, Yuan Feng, Wei Song, Guopeng Zhou, Zonglin Cai, Xiao Yan, Enhai Zhao
-
Publication number: 20240328340Abstract: A swirl structure-based exhaust aftertreatment device for an underground mining diesel vehicle comprises a water tank, a PM collection tank, an inlet tube, a high-speed rotary exhaust separator, an exhaust catalytic converter, a circulating NOx selective catalytic reduction system and an exhaust tube. The high-speed rotary exhaust separator comprises a Laval tube, a throat tube, a swirl tube and a first deposition tube. The concentration of toxic and harmful components in exhaust can be decreased below a concentration threshold, thus avoiding pipeline blockage caused by PM accumulation.Type: ApplicationFiled: December 26, 2023Publication date: October 3, 2024Inventors: WEN NIE, CHENGYI LIU, YUN HUA, WEIMIN CHENG, XIAO YAN, FENGNING YU, ZILIAN ZHU, JIE LIAN, CHENWANG JIANG, CHUANXING CHENG, HAONAN ZHANG
-
Publication number: 20240309960Abstract: The deluge valve assembly includes: a deluge valve, in which the deluge valve includes a water inlet cavity, a water outlet cavity, and a diaphragm cavity. The water inlet cavity is suitable for communication with the fire protection pipe network so as to make water from the fire protection pipe network flow into the water inlet cavity; a water inlet pipeline, in which an inlet of the water inlet pipeline is connected with the water inlet cavity, and an outlet of the water inlet pipeline is connected with the diaphragm cavity; a water outlet pipeline, in which an inlet of the water outlet pipeline is connected with the diaphragm cavity; reinforcement members, in which at least two of the deluge valve, the water inlet pipeline, and the water outlet pipeline are connected through the reinforcement members. The deluge valve assembly has advantages of good performance in anti-vibration and reliability.Type: ApplicationFiled: November 13, 2023Publication date: September 19, 2024Inventors: Xiao WU, Jilan ZHANG, Yong JIANG, Peng YANG, Xiao YAN, Quanjun DONG, Yinan LIU, Cheng LI, Hongquan ZHAO, Jinchao CHEN, Shuangquan GUAN, Qiangqiang YANG
-
Patent number: 12091345Abstract: Present disclosure discloses a method for recovering phosphorus and iron, and use thereof. The method comprises the following steps of: S1: mixing iron salt and phosphorus-containing sewage according to the amount of the phosphorus-containing sewage to obtain a mixture, the concentration of the iron salt in the obtained mixture being 4 mg/L to 25 mg/L, fermenting the mixture at 20° C. to 60° C. for 2 days to 10 days, taking a fermentation supernatant, and removing the impurities; and S2: oxidizing the fermentation supernatant subjected to impurity removal in an acidic system. The present disclosure provides the method for recovering phosphorus and iron, which realizes high efficient recycling of phosphorus resources in sludge.Type: GrantFiled: January 5, 2024Date of Patent: September 17, 2024Assignee: TSINGHUA SHENZHEN INTERNATIONAL GRADUATE SCHOOLInventors: Lin Lin, Xuan Wang, Xiao-yan Li, Yijiao Chang, Zhu Liang, Bing Li
-
Patent number: 12085004Abstract: A swirl structure-based exhaust aftertreatment device for an underground mining diesel vehicle comprises a water tank, a PM collection tank, an inlet tube, a high-speed rotary exhaust separator, an exhaust catalytic converter, a circulating NOx selective catalytic reduction system and an exhaust tube. The high-speed rotary exhaust separator comprises a Laval tube, a throat tube, a swirl tube and a first deposition tube. The concentration of toxic and harmful components in exhaust can be decreased below a concentration threshold, thus avoiding pipeline blockage caused by PM accumulation.Type: GrantFiled: December 26, 2023Date of Patent: September 10, 2024Assignee: SHANDONG UNIVERSITY OF SCIENCE AND TECHNOLOGYInventors: Wen Nie, Chengyi Liu, Yun Hua, Weimin Cheng, Xiao Yan, Fengning Yu, Zilian Zhu, Jie Lian, Chenwang Jiang, Chuanxing Cheng, Haonan Zhang
-
Publication number: 20240295607Abstract: A method, an apparatus and a device for identifying battery parameters, and a storage medium are provided.Type: ApplicationFiled: November 29, 2023Publication date: September 5, 2024Applicant: Shanghai Makesens Energy Storage Technology Co., Ltd.Inventors: Xiaohua CHEN, Zhimin ZHOU, Qiong WEI, Xiao YAN, Enhai ZHAO, Pingchao HAO, Zhou YANG
-
Publication number: 20240290330Abstract: A system for providing a personalized assistant within a network-based communication service includes one or more processors and a memory storage device storing instructions thereon. During a network-based communication session, the system receives a query from a computing device of a first communication session participant and processes the query by determining that a second communication session participant has shared content via a content sharing feature of the network-based communication service. In response, the system provides the query and at least a portion of the shared content as input to a model, which dynamically constructs a prompt for use as input with a generative language model. The system then presents the prompt as input to the generative language model, receives a response as output from the generative language model, and causes presentation of the response to be presented to the communication session participant.Type: ApplicationFiled: June 23, 2023Publication date: August 29, 2024Inventors: Xiao Yan Lu, Amir Kantor, Ido Priness, Shiraz Jitendra Cupala, Kevin Michael Carter, Adi Miller, Kumud Ranjan, Shyam Gupta, Gautam Jain, Yasemin Cenberoglu, Shai Ifrach, Shlomi Maliah, Jaime Teevan, Lan Ye